Sexual harassment caused by their customers and suppliers could lead to recruitment agencies having to pay unlimited damages under new legislation.

Employers can face a tribunal if they fail to take reasonable steps to protect staff from third-party harassment once they have been warned.

A third of managers are thinking of leaving their job in the near future, according to research by management training organisation, Roffey Park Institute.

The survey found that 10% of managers "strongly agreed" with the statement "I am thinking of leaving in the near future", while 23% "agreed".
